FT: What are your priorities for this G20 summit?
TA: In terms of the priorities for the G20, I would say that against the backdrop of the current economic slowdown that the G20 nations account for 80 per cent of the GDP that is generated by the 193 countries around the world. Therefore I think that the top priority for the G20 is to try and secure economic recovery for these countries accounting for 80 per cent of GDP working hand in hand together.
